    Timon and Pumbaa are the adoptive father-figures of Simba and major characters in the 1994 animated Disney masterpiece The Lion King. They are voiced by Nathan Lane and Ernie Sabella in the animated franchise and voiced by Billy Eichner and Seth Rogen in the 2019 live-action remake.

    Trivia

    • Timon and Pumbaa were not in the original script of the 1994 animated movie, but Nathan Lane and Ernie Sabella were so funny when they auditioned for the hyenas, so Disney made characters just for them.
